Kinetics and Mechanisms of Synergetic Pressure-Sintering and Mechanical Behavior of High-Strength Ceramics
Abstract
The report presents a summary of the following research efforts: (1) a major effort was devoted to studying the synergetic effect of the gamma to alpha alumina phase transformation on pressure-sintering kinetics of high- density alumina ceramics. (2) An extensive program was also initiated with the purpose of relating diffusion coefficients observed for ceramics subjected to pressure-sintering or press-forging operations with interdiffusion coefficients observed in diffusion experiments. (3) In addition to the studies on basic mechanisms in the densification kinetics of ceramics, considerable attention was also devoted to studies of the mechanical behavior of ceramic materials. (4) Additional studies of the mechanical behavior of ceramic materials involved an analysis of fracture energies.
